Quang Ninh Combined Cycle power station is a 1,500 MW gas power station in Quang Ninh, Vietnam. It is operated by Quang Ninh LNG Power JSC [100%]. Based on its capacity (estimated), it can supply roughly 1.7 million homes (estimated). It ranks #47 of 298 Vietnam power plants by installed capacity. In context, gas supplies about 6.2% of Vietnam's electricity; the national grid averages 461 gCO₂/kWh (45.4% low-carbon) (2025).

In context: how this plant compares

At 1,500 MW, Quang Ninh Combined Cycle power station is below the median gas plant in Vietnam (2,250 MW). Technically it is described as CCGT; combined-cycle with a heat-recovery steam generator (HRSG). Its current lifecycle status is “Pre Construction” — so it is not yet, or no longer, generating at full output. Gas plants burn natural gas either in open-cycle turbines for fast peaking, or in combined-cycle units that recover exhaust heat in an HRSG to reach roughly 55–62% efficiency — the cleanest-burning fossil option.

Site climate & environmental severity

For a plant’s outdoor hardware — heat-recovery steam generators (HRSG), expansion joints, valves, flanges and their insulation — the local climate sets how fast unprotected steel and coatings degrade. This site sits in an aggressive, high-corrosion environment (estimated ISO 9223 class C5 — Very high), with marine salt corrosion the leading environmental stress.
